
Bucks Face Make-or-Break Weekend
About this episode
The Milwaukee Bucks, clinging to play-in hopes after back-to-back losses, host the Utah Jazz and Orlando Magic this weekend. Giannis Antetokounmpo returns from injury but on a minutes limit. The Jazz, a bottom team in the West, struggle on the road. A win against Utah sets up better chances against Orlando, testing the Bucks resilience.

0:00On March 8th, here's the latest surrounding the NBA. The Milwaukee Bucks are facing a Maker Break weekend at home after back-to-back tough losses that have them clinging to play in hopes. Sitting at 26 wins and 35 losses, they host the Utah Jazz on Saturday, followed by the Orlando Magic and Phoenix Suns. A strong showing here could keep their season alive. Earlier this week, they fell hard to the Boston Celtics in Giannis N, Antitokeo Own, Bowe's return from a calf injury, then blew a halftime lead against. The Atlanta Hawks, now with little margin for error, the Bucks need to turn things around fast against weaker opponents. The Jazz at 19 wins and 44 losses are one of the West's bottom teams and likely headed for another lottery pick. Milwaukee swept them in both games last season and holds a 60-53 all-time edge. Utah struggles on the road at 8 wins and 23 losses. Giannis remains on a strict minutes limit that coach Doc Rivers plans to follow closely,
1:03while Kevin Porter Jr. sits out with knee swelling. The Jazz have their own injury woes, missing key players like Lori Markinan and others, which could give Milwaukee an edge if they capitalize. Tip off his Saturday at 8 p.m. Eastern at Fizzair Form. A win here sets up better chances against Orlando on Sunday, testing the Bucks is resilience like never before this season.
